8.5 Slewing bearing
8.5.1 Checking the screws
• Comply also with the run-in regulations; à p. 4 - 1.
Tools – Torque wrench.
– Auxiliary tools for the torque wrench; à p. 8 - 23.
Prerequisites – The crane must be rigged with an outrigger span of at least 8.66 x 5.31 m
(28.4x17.4ft) and be level;
à Operating manual.
– The auxiliary hoist or alternatively the compensation weight
0.5 t (1,100 lbs) is rigged.
– No further counterweight must be been rigged; .
– In addition, the tyres on the 3rd axle line should be removed so that
freedom of movement under the slewing bearing is improved.
– The main boom must be fully retracted and raised to 66°; à Operating
manual
.
– The current load must not exceed 1 t (2,200 lbs) – if necessary unreeve the
hook block.
– The slewing range 360° around the truck crane must be secured.
– The engine is not running and is secured against unauthorised use;
à p. 2 - 3.

Risk of damage to the screws on the slewing bearing
All screws were tightened at the factory with a certain torque, and this
should be checked during maintenance. Only slight tightening of the
screws is permissible, if required.
You may not slacken the bolts and re-tighten them, or completely unscrew
and then reuse them.
If the superstructure has to be removed from the carrier, only a completely
new set of bolts may be used to reinstall the superstructure. Only original
bolts manufactured according to the factory specifications may be used.
